From Versace, Dreamer is a 1996 oriental fougère EDT by perfumer Jean-Pierre Bethouart — one of the most enduring and distinctive masculines in the Versace catalog, a poetic, slightly romantic composition built around a lavender-sage-mandarin opening, a tobacco-rose-carnation-geranium heart, and a warm tonka bean-fir-vetiver-cedar base that reviewers describe as a uniquely dreamy, softly powdery tobacco masculine that sits comfortably alongside JPG Le Male in the pantheon of iconic 90s men's orientals. Lavender, sage, and mandarin orange open with a clean, lightly herbal, slightly sweet freshness — the lavender delivering a classic masculine warmth that is the opening's most prominent and recognizable note, the sage threading in a cool, herbal-aromatic crispness that keeps the lavender from going too powdery too quickly, and the mandarin contributing a warm, rounded citrus sweetness that lifts the herbal opening into something more approachable and accessible than a straight lavender fougère. Tobacco, rose, carnation, and geranium carry the heart into the composition's most distinctive and memorable phase — the tobacco delivering a dry, slightly honey-tinged leafy warmth that is the soul of Dreamer and the quality that sets it apart from every other lavender masculine on the market, the rose contributing a classic velvety femininity that gives the heart its romantic character, the carnation threading in a warm, spiced floralness, and the geranium adding a cool, rosy-green depth. Tonka bean, fir, vetiver, and cedar close with a warm, slightly resinous, earthy base — the tonka adding a soft vanilla-like sweetness, the fir threading in a cool conifer freshness, and the vetiver and cedar providing a dry, lasting woody-earthy foundation. 6–8 hours with moderate projection. Best in fall and winter; a romantic, timeless masculine for evenings and date nights.
